Prohibited use

Do not use RequestFlow to harm the service, other customers, clients, or third parties.

  • Do not upload unlawful, harmful, misleading, abusive, or malicious content.
  • Do not use RequestFlow to distribute malware, credential theft, phishing, spam, or fraudulent requests.
  • Do not attempt to bypass access controls, probe non-public systems, scrape private endpoints, or abuse rate limits.
  • Do not impersonate another firm, client, provider, or RequestFlow representative.

Security testing

Security reports are welcome, but testing must be responsible and must not put customer data or service availability at risk.

  • Do not access, modify, delete, or exfiltrate data that is not yours.
  • Do not run denial-of-service testing, destructive scanning, spam, phishing, or social engineering.
  • Report security concerns through /security-contact/.

Firm responsibility

Your firm remains responsible for how it uses RequestFlow with clients.

  • Use accurate checklist item names and send requests only to the intended client or contact.
  • Maintain your own compliance program, written information security plan, professional obligations, client consent practices, and records-retention decisions.
  • Remove users, revoke links, and delete data when access is no longer appropriate.
